Is there any difference between coinbase, myetherwallet and blockchain? Which one is better in your opinion?

Yes. there is a huge difference. Coinbase is a service really, not a wallet. You never really have control over your bitcoin if you store them there, since they own the private keys.

MEW is pretty solid, but only for ethereum. Although i believe the official ethereum client has way more features then them.

Blockchain.info is a webwallet, they have no access to your keys, but neither do you (unless you export them, which is almost impossible. ( or derive the seed ofcours, which can be buggy.)
It also misses a lot of functionality if you compare it to something like https://electrum.org/#home
